PLA Army Service Academy         
UNIVERSITY IN CHINA
University of Logistics; Logistical Engineering University of PLA
The PLA Army Service Academy (), formerly known as the Logistical Engineering University of PLA or University of Logistics, is an institution of higher learning in Chongqing, focusing on military engineering. It is affiliated to the General Logistics Department of the People's Liberation Army of China and is one of the leading military engineering academies in the country.

MANAGEMENT OF THE FLOW OF RESOURCES
Logistical; Logistics management; Supply and transport; Logistics Overview; Elogistics; E-logistics; Supply and Transport; Logistical support; Certified Professional Logistician; Logistics Management; In-house logistics; Business logistics; Logistics companies; Logistically; Logistical obstacle
Logistics is generally the detailed organization and implementation of a complex operation. In a general business sense, logistics is the management of the flow of things between the point of origin and the point of consumption to meet the requirements of customers or corporations.

Information logistics

Information Logistics (IL) deals with the flow of information between human and / or machine actors within or between any number of organizations that in turn form a value creating network (see, e.g.). IL is closely related to information management, information operations and information technology.
